Maggie Throup: A Conservative Voice in the UK Parliament
Maggie Throup, a name that might not be on the tip of everyone's tongue, is a British Conservative politician who has been making waves in the UK Parliament. Born in 1957, she represents the Erewash constituency, having been elected as a Member of Parliament (MP) in 2015. Throup has been involved in various roles, including serving as the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Vaccines and Public Health during the COVID-19 pandemic. Her work has been pivotal in shaping the UK's health policies during one of the most challenging times in recent history. But who is Maggie Throup, and what drives her political journey?
Throup's career before politics was rooted in science and healthcare, having studied biology and worked in medical diagnostics. This background has undoubtedly influenced her approach to policy-making, especially in health-related areas. Her scientific perspective is a refreshing addition to the political landscape, where decisions often require a balance between scientific evidence and public sentiment. Throup's role during the pandemic was crucial, as she was responsible for overseeing the vaccine rollout, a task that required meticulous planning and execution.
